I've heard great things about the Quattro all-wheel drive system in Audi's A4 models, but I'm not sure how it actually works. Can you explain the technology behind it?
ReplyThe Quattro all-wheel drive system uses a center differential to distribute torque between the front and rear axles, ensuring optimal power and traction for all driving situations.
Audi's Quattro technology is unique because it uses a self-locking center differential, constantly monitoring the grip of each tire and adjusting power distribution accordingly for maximum control.
